“Burglar,” the comedy-mystery starring Whoopi Goldberg and Bob Goldthwait, got off to a fast start on the Billboard magazine video rental chart, entering at No. 11. This one should at least crack the Top Five. Goldberg, a big star in the rental market, has two other movies on the chart--”The Color Purple” (No. 10) and “Jumpin’ Jack Flash” (No. 28), which has been on the chart for more than four months. Two other chart newcomers--”Blind Date” (No. 14) and “Some Kind of Wonderful” (No. 15)--should make the Top 10 in the next week or two.

“An American Tail” continues to lead the sales chart and may stay there until mid-October, when another feature length cartoon, “Lady and the Tramp,” will be a likely replacement. Other sales charts: “Golf My Way With Jack Nicklaus” and Bob Mann’s “Automatic Golf” top the recreational sports chart; “The Doors: Live at the Hollywood Bowl” is the best-selling music videocassette.

* This fantasy-screwball comedy about an Egyptian princess who returns to Earth as a department-store dummy--that comes to life only for the window-dresser she loves--was an out-of-left-field hit in the theaters, racking up more than $40 million. Now “Mannequin” is an instant rental hit as well, debuting at No. 6.
